7
North Lodge in St Leonards on sea, gateway to 'Burton's St Leonards'.
The North Lodge, designed by James Burton 1830. Sir Henry Rider Haggard, author of 'King Solomon's Mines', 'She', and other fine novels - lived here from 1918 to 1923.
